2022-23 JFC High School Basketball Leagues 9th-12th

Season Dates: 11/02/2022 to 02/25/2023

Jackson Friends Church High School Basketball Leagues are for grades 9th – 12th. The leagues are recreational and are also “bring your own team”. MINIMUM OF EIGHT PLAYERS ON A TEAM. Players will sign up online and put down their team name or players on their team, to be linked together. Individuals that do not have enough players to make a team may sign up individually, and if there are enough kids to make a team, we will make extra teams. Almost always at the 9th/10th grade level, we are able to make at least one team, sometimes two, from individual players. If for some reason we are not able to put the high schooler on a team, you will receive FULL REFUND (only thing we can’t get back is the $3 service fee). At the 11th/12th grade level, for any players without a team, we usually ask some of our current teams if they would take on an extra player. Sometimes it works out, sometimes it does not. Again a FULL REFUND will be given to anyone who does not end up getting on a team, if signing up as an individual.

Cost for registration is $90 for either high school league and for those that need a jersey, it is $17 for a jersey (yours to keep and reuse). All jerseys for teams must be JFC jerseys (unless a team has all the same custom uniforms, MUST BE APPROVED by league director). 

The league is split up into two divisions:

Freshmen/Sophomore Division

Junior/Senior Division

EVERY TEAM MUST HAVE AN ADULT 21 OR OLDER SITTING ON THE BENCH. It can be a parent or whoever you want, but they must be 21 or older. This helps us keep the players on the bench under control during the game, with the presence of a parent/adult. Must have this throughout the season to be eligible for playoffs.

GAME SCHEDULE FOR DIVISIONS

FRESHMAN/SOPHOMORE DIVISION: Games for the freshman/sophomore division will be played on Friday evenings, with most games being at Jackson Friends Church and some games being played at The Rock of Canal Fulton (709 Elm Ridge Ave, Canal Fulton, OH 44614). There are at a total of 10 games in the regular season (December 2nd, 9th, 16th, January 6th, 13th, 20th, 27th, February 3rd, 10th and 17th). The top eight teams from the league will make the playoffs, which will start February 24th.

JUNIOR/SENIOR DIVISION: ON FRIDAY EVENINGS at THE ROCK OF CANAL FULTON (709 Elm Ridge Ave, Canal Fulton, OH 44614), roughly 5 to 7 minutes drive from Jackson Friends Church. Games will be every Friday running December 2nd, 9th, 16th, January 6th, 13th, 20th, 27th, February 3rd, 10th and 17th. As the Rock has two regulation sized basketball courts, there will be two games for each hour. There will be a total of ten regular season games, and the top eight teams make the playoffs. Playoffs will begin February 24th.

Each game will feature a half time devotion/prayer (could be after the game, depending on league directors decision) with the players. We want to make sure participants have an enjoyable experience with the game and hear about Jesus.

Before the season begins there will be an email sent out to parents/participants on the expectations for this season. It was also be reiterated at the first games of the year. Players and everyone alike will be held to a high standard, as we want this league running at it’s highest potential!

There are no practices at the high school level for JFC basketball, due to gym schedule unavailability. HOWEVER, if some teams want to practice and can make it work right after school (4 – 5 PM) on Mondays or Tuesdays, that is a possibility. It worked out for a handful of teams last year, but those are the only times we have available because of the time our K-8th grade leagues take up the gym during the week.
